Tasting notes
The 2015 Vosne Romanee Aux Reas was just a little disjointed on the nose when I tasted it, just missing some of the precocity of the growing season. The palate is medium-bodied with slightly chewy tannin, good depth and body with a spicy, quite muscular finish. It handles the 50% new oak well, although overall I would just be looking for a little more detail and sophistication.

About the producer

Descended from the Gros family of Vosne-Romanée, Anne-Françoise Gros established her own domaine in 1988. Today her children, Caroline and Mathias Parent, run the estate, which has some impressive holdings, focused in and around Vosne-Romanée.
